Ready to Build National Defense Through Women
Alicia Hart discusses a patriotic program by a famous beauty salon to train healthy capable women for defense tasks. The plan promotes exercise posture and lifting techniques, walking two to three miles daily, and carrying loads with bent knees and proper spine alignment to prevent strain and rupture. It urges women to prepare now to support heavy workloads during emergency times.

Life Is War in Chungking
In Chungking uncertainty dominates daily life as residents endure heat, make do in crude shelters, and face air raids with grim resolve. The city earns its reputation as the world’s most uncomfortable capital as many foreigners suffer stomach ailments while the Yangtze River water is tainted by yellow mud.

Chungking under siege as prices soar and life tightens
The report describes extreme shortages in Chungking with rice at two dollars a pound, imported liquor exhausted, limited electricity and telephone service, few foreign restaurants, and rationing absent. Hospitals largely destroyed, relief scarce, yet the city presses on to sustain Chiang Kai-shek's war machine.
